In a world more and more shaped by formulas, records, and intelligent systems, the job of the computer expert has actually turned into one of the most significant line of work of the 21st century. From the smartphones in our pockets to the global infrastructure of the internet, pc scientists layout, build, as well as fine-tune the systems that determine modern lifestyle. As yet, the specialty is actually far more than technological problem-solving; it is actually a fusion of reasoning, creative thinking, mathematics, and human-centered reasoning that continues to completely transform culture at a phenomenal pace. Itamar Mountain View, CA
The Sources of Computer Technology
The groundworks of information technology could be mapped back to theoretical mathematics and also very early mechanical calculation. Among the best renowned trailblazers is Alan Turing, whose work in the course of the mid-20th century laid the theoretical underpinning for modern processing. Turing’s concept of a “universal machine” displayed that any type of calculation could, in principle, be executed through a singular abstract device provided the best guidelines. This academic breakthrough ended up being the manner for modern programmable pcs.
An additional essential number is John von Neumann, that launched the stored-program style that most computers still use today. This construction allows directions and also records to be kept in the very same mind space, permitting flexibility and also productivity in computation. All together, these very early thinkers transformed computation from an academic idea right into an efficient design specialty. Itamar California
Defining the Task of a Computer Researcher
A computer system expert is certainly not merely a coder, although programming is typically portion of the job. As an alternative, pc researchers study calculation on its own– its own limitations, probabilities, and also functions. They develop protocols, build program devices, assess records frameworks, and also look into emerging industries like artificial intelligence, cybersecurity, and also quantum computing.
At its own center, information technology inquires vital inquiries: What troubles can be fixed through computers? Just how successfully can they be actually fixed? As well as what does it suggest for an unit to “assume” or even make decisions? These inquiries stretch much beyond equipments, touching viewpoint, math, and intellectual scientific research.
For example, algorithm layout focuses on creating detailed procedures for solving issues successfully. A well-designed algorithm may minimize calculation opportunity coming from years to seconds. Information frameworks, on the other hand, calculate exactly how details is stashed and accessed, affecting the performance of whatever coming from search engines to social networks systems.
The Development of the Specialty
Computer technology has progressed rapidly since the mid-20th century. Early calculating bodies were actually gigantic devices utilized predominantly for army computations as well as scientific analysis. In time, nonetheless, the field grown into personal processing, social network, as well as ultimately worldwide connectivity via the world wide web.
The increase of program engineering in the overdue 20th century marked a work schedule from segregated programming activities to big device concept. Computer system experts started doing work in groups to construct complex bodies including functioning systems, databases, and also distributed networks.
Today, the area is actually highly interdisciplinary. Pc scientists team up with biologists in computational genomics, along with economic experts in mathematical exchanging, and also with performers in electronic media creation. This development demonstrates the flexibility of computational reasoning throughout domain names.
Artificial Intelligence and Modern Frontiers
Among the best amazing locations in computer technology today is actually artificial intelligence (AI). AI devices are actually developed to carry out duties that generally require individual cleverness, like identifying speech, analyzing pictures, or choosing.
Modern artificial intelligence relies greatly on machine learning, where units find out patterns from information as opposed to adhering to clearly scheduled policies. This strategy has actually led to discoveries in natural language processing, self-governing autos, and also health care diagnosis units.
Nonetheless, AI also brings up moral and social questions. Problems like mathematical prejudice, data privacy, as well as work variation require cautious factor to consider. Personal computer scientists today are actually certainly not only designers yet additionally honest guardians of effective innovations that shape human habits and society.
The Human Side of Computer
While information technology is actually heavily technical, it is eventually a human-centered field. The most successful units are actually those that comprehend and also respond to human needs properly. This is actually where areas like human-computer communication (HCI) become crucial.
A pc scientist need to consider functionality, accessibility, and also consumer experience. As an example, creating software program for aesthetically reduced users demands well thought-out assimilation of assistive modern technologies. Likewise, social networking sites systems need to balance engagement with mental health and wellness points to consider.
One of the absolute most prominent have a place in this region was actually Poise Receptacle, that aided cultivate early computer programming languages and encouraged for even more human-readable code. Her job showed that figuring out units must be accessible not simply to makers but additionally to folks.
Obstacles in the Field
Even with its own development, computer science encounters many problems. One primary concern is actually cybersecurity. As systems end up being much more linked, they additionally end up being much more prone to assaults. Computer scientists need to consistently develop brand new techniques to shield data and also preserve trust in digital devices.
One more challenge is actually scalability. As records increases significantly, devices must be made to handle substantial quantities effectively. Cloud processing and also circulated units have actually become services, however they introduce their own difficulties.
In addition, there is actually a growing issue about durability. Big computer infrastructures consume substantial electricity, urging analysts to look into greener processing strategies.
The Future of Computer Science
The future of computer science is actually both thrilling and unclear. Quantum computing, as an example, guarantees to revolutionize analytic by leveraging the principles of quantum auto mechanics. If understood at range, it could possibly solve issues currently beyond the scope of timeless computer systems.
Meanwhile, developments in AI remain to press borders in creativity as well as hands free operation. Units are currently with the ability of producing fine art, writing text message, and assisting in scientific invention.
Nonetheless, the future will definitely additionally rely on just how responsibly these technologies are built. Personal computer scientists will certainly play a crucial duty in making sure that innovation aligns along with reliable concepts and popular welfare.